Output d7b533e384a7f6403c86dc60724b86bd61ae1a86fc35efc1506efe1cde7b4e5f:11

value
1743131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deba878f0b67e96f1973f0ebbdcac057967d7f7f OP_EQUAL
address
3MzhPRpnEgt4MRWYGtFNxNJiYbiFq7sjvk
transaction
d7b533e384a7f6403c86dc60724b86bd61ae1a86fc35efc1506efe1cde7b4e5f
confirmations
482184
spent
true